Gerrit Hendricks

Birth1654 - Kriegsheim,Upper Rhine,Palatinate,Germany
Death1740 - Germantown,Philadelphia,Pennsylvania
MotherJohanna Maria Janssen
FatherAntonius Hendrick Geeritsen

Born in Kriegsheim,Upper Rhine,Palatinate,Germany on 1654 to Antonius Hendrick Geeritsen and Johanna Maria Janssen. Gerrit Hendricks married Sytje Boekenoogen and had 8 children. He passed away on 1740 in Germantown,Philadelphia,Pennsylvania.
